Auto Care Association releases Catalog Assessment Tool

Aug. 11, 2023
This new tool is designed to identify discrepancies and help companies quickly rectify errors in their data.

The Auto Care Association announced its latest digital product, the Catalog Assessment Tool.

This new tool, which is free for Auto Care Data Standards subscribers to use through the Auto Care VIP Data Standards dashboard, is designed to identify discrepancies and help companies quickly rectify errors in their data. 

“We’re so excited to assist in advancing the industry’s content by providing this new data feature,” said Jonathan Larsen, vice president, standards, digital products, Auto Care Association. “As more subscribers take advantage of the tool, we can begin to observe when and how quickly this data is being embraced within the industry.”

The Catalog Assessment Tool will help businesses by:

  • removing duplicated communication and distribution efforts;
  • save time and money
  • lower supply chain costs;
  • increase product introduction and speed to market;
  • increase sales and operational efficiencies; and reduce returns
